In this paper, a new generic development in the medical case report will be presented as a useful tool in the broadly understood medical context. A case report describes new diseases or their novel aspects, and its new interactive type additionally allows readers to comment on published cases and features patients’ first person accounts. This development may become a useful tool in the teaching of medical English, especially in terms of terminology and frequently used expressions, in medical training, educating through case-based teaching, as well as in professional development, through incorporating the patient into professional communication and emphasising doctor’s reflection.
